An open or shorted primary coil typically suggests that there is an issue with current flow in the circuit, often leading to excess current. In a transformer or any electrical system, the primary coil plays a critical role in establishing the magnetic field necessary for operation. If the primary coil is open, it means that the circuit is incomplete, and no current can flow. Conversely, if the coil is shorted, it creates a low-resistance path for the current, which can lead to excessive current flow.

When this excess current occurs, it can cause protective devices, such as fuses or circuit breakers, to trip or blow to prevent damage to the system. Therefore, the indication of an open or shorted primary coil aligns with the idea that there could be excess current leading to a blown fuse or tripped circuit breaker. This understanding is key to diagnosing issues in electrical systems, especially in applications involving transformers or similar equipment.
